The deadline for ACESJU Cohort 3 applications is February 15, 2013.  The cohort will begin in June 2013 with a summer session of classes at Saint Joseph’s University.

Who we are looking for: Our next cohort is open to recent college graduates (including those who will be graduating in May 2013) seeking teaching placements and certification in grades 4-12. We will offer an M.S. in Education degree with Certification in Elementary/Middle Years, Grades 4-8 and an M.S. in Education degree with Certification in Secondary with a Content Area, Grades 7-12.  You will have the opportunity to list your teaching level preference on the application.

These degrees and certification options require certain prerequisites.  Applicants will need to have graduated with a degree in their desired teaching field (i.e. English, History, Biology, etc…) or have a satisfactory number of credits in a given teaching field (i.e. 21 credits in English and 21 credits in Math). Certain exceptions may be made for comparable courses or degrees. For example, an applicant may have taken courses in Communications or Journalism instead of English, or Political Science instead of History. Interested applicants can request that ACESJU review their academic background to determine if prerequisites are met.  Additionally, applicants must meet the academic requirements for admissions to Saint Joseph's University's M.S. Education program.

The Alliance for Catholic Education at Saint Joseph's University (ACESJU) is a member of the University Consortium for Catholic Education (UCCE). This consortium establishes and supports a collaborative cadre of primarily Catholic colleges and universities as they design and implement graduate teaching service programs, for the purpose of supporting Catholic/Parochial education in the United States.
